LONDON (Reuters) - Formula One has sounded out MotoGP for cooperation and advice as the sport embarks on a period of change under new owners Liberty Media.
Ross Brawn, the former Ferrari technical director who has run three teams and is now Formula One's managing director for motorsport, said he was open to learning lessons from any other series.
